Review of Millions (2005) by Tana B — 05 Mar 2008
This film charmed me, and touched me on so many levels. Not only is the cinematography brilliantly done, especially the tracking shots, but it's spot on in casting and screenplay.
Early on in the film, in a scene with the younger boy, my husband took the words out of my mouth and said, "Where's the tiger?" Meaning Hobbes. It's like Radio Flyer (without the ACTUAL violence) crossed with Calvin and Hobbes with It's a Wonderful Life. Somehow.
Nothing like a little optimism.
